If you are a fan of psychological thrillers, then this book is one for you to read. After reading the publishers blurb, I was hooked and so began me waiting to see if my request would be approved. When it was, I began reading and reading and reading until sometime around 3 am when I finished. I could not stop. The writers ability to keep the story suspenseful is amazing. The story starts with Meg as she arrives home hoping to see her husband, Luke, and their two children. Unfortunately, when she arrived no one was home. There was note that said they had gone for a walk. After waiting long enough, Meg goes looking for them but to no avail. Calling the police is her only option now, but that will mean having to explain some marital problems. Things she wants to keep secret. Where could her family be? Well written with great detail and a plot that thickens as you read further. My heart was pounding as I got closer to the end. What I thought would happen was definitely not the case. I was blown away by the ending. You will be rooting for different characters and wondering what was going to happen next so much that you just have to finish it. This book deserves a 10.

As soon as I finished The Honeymoon and realized that Love you Gone was sitting in my to-be-read pile, I pulled up that one on my Kindle app....and read it almost straight through. (The family was watching a marathon of old Godzilla movies and didn't miss me at all.)

In this one, a woman arrives late at the rental cottage where she's supposed to meet her husband and children. They've left things strewn all over the rooms and a note saying they went out for a walk and will be back soon. It's several hours before Mel runs out of potential explanations and decides to start calling local emergency rooms and restaurants to see if she can find them on her own. Finally, she calls the local police. She doesn't tell them everything about her family, not at first. With two unreliable narrators, this one kept me guessing and unsure whose version of the events to trust.

‘Hello? Police? My husband and our children… they’re gone.’

When Mel arrives at the holiday cottage in the Lake District, she expects to find the heating on and her husband Luke and the two children waiting for her. Maybe a bottle of wine open…

Instead, there is just a note on the side, saying they’ve gone out for a walk.

But they aren’t back several hours later, and Mel knows something is wrong. Really wrong. When a search doesn’t find them, she has to confess to the police that her marriage isn’t all that it seems.

Even if that risks her own secrets being revealed…
